  1. Dissociation of carbon dioxide in an Al/Al2O3 microchannel plasma reactor at atmospheric pressure

    The dissociation of CO2, using a microcavity plasma in an Al/Al2O3 reactor flowing pure CO2 is achieved with a maximum energy efficiency of 12.4%. This figure corresponds to a maximum dissociation rate of ~70 g/kWh. Additionally, optical emission spectra in UV and visible regions show the evidence …
